Unilever is a British-Dutch multinational consumer goods company dual-listed in the United Kingdom and the Netherlands. Formed from companies founded in the 1870s, Unilever now regroups more than 400 brands, including Axe/Lynx, Dove, Omo, Heartbrand ice creams, Hellmann's, Knorr, Lipton, Lux, Magnum, Rexona/Degree, Sunsilk, and Surf.

The market capitalization of a company, more simply referred to as "market cap", is the total market value of a publicly traded company's outstanding shares. It is often considered as a key indicator of what a company is worth.
